PHOTO: (Lt: to Rt)  Sarah Kearsley Wooler Ty Gobaith Fundraising Manager, Debbie Williams, Ruth Hughes, Joanna Hughes ( Proprietor), Lucy Williams, Beth Bithell  St David’s Hospice Fundraising Coordinator.  Staff at Enigma Hairdressing, Llandudno hand over cheques totalling £1306.74 to St David’s (Adult) Hospice and Ty Gobaith Children Hospice. The fundraising took place as part of Enigma’s ‘10 years of trading’ celebrations.

Celebration of Christmas Carol Service takes place today (Thurs 17th), 7pm at the Holy Trinity Church, Llandudno. The annual service is organised by St. David’s Hospice and Ty Gobaith Children’s Hospice to say thanks to their loyal supporters. The event is free of charge and an invite is extended to the communities of Anglesey, Gwynedd and Conwy. There will be a charity collection on the evening and refreshments available after the concert. The service will be led by Rev Jane Allen. Barbara Yates is the winner of the Doll’s House Raffle which took place on Friday. The house was kindly made and donated by Sid Walker of Rhos on Sea to the hospice in memory of his wife Brenda. The raffle raised over £1300.

Betws y Coed Support Group held their annual Christmas Fair at the Glan Aber Hotel last month raising £905.05. Many thanks to the group, the Glan Aber and everyone who supported the event.

St David’s Hospice are still collecting old mobile phone plus stamps, foreign coins and old currency. This continues to bring in a steady income. Donations can be dropped of at the various Hospice Shops across the area or brought in to the Hospice in Abbey Road.
